Construction Techniques and Materials Used in Middle Eastern Bunkers
Construction techniques for military bunkers in the Middle East emphasize durability and resistance to regional threats. Reinforced concrete remains the primary material, providing robust protection against explosive forces and chemical attacks. Its density and composition are often customized with additives to enhance strength and durability.
The use of locally sourced materials, such as volcanic rock and sandstone, complements concrete structures and assists in camouflage and climate adaptation. These materials are selected for their availability and inherent insulation properties, helping maintain internal stability.
Advanced construction methods include underground excavation with specialized tunneling techniques to minimize surface disruption and increase concealment. In some regions, modular prefabrication allows rapid deployment and easier expansion of bunkers, especially during escalating conflicts.
Given regional security challenges, military bunkers in the Middle East often incorporate strategic features like blast walls, underground water supplies, and ventilation systems, all integrated during construction using a combination of traditional and modern engineering practices.
